Selecting the Ideal Sod: Types, Resilience, and Appearance
While visual appeal counts, you'll select sod by matching species and cultivar traits to Fayetteville's transition-zone climate and your site's use profile. For high-traffic areas with direct sunlight, consider hybrid bermudagrass (Cynodon dactylon × C. transvaalensis) with fine texture, rapid stolon/rhizome spread, and excellent wear tolerance. Zoysia (Zoysia japonica, Z. matrella) offers dense turf, slower growth, and cold resilience; choose Drought resistant cultivars with documented ET reduction. For areas with limited sunlight, St. Augustine (Stenotaphrum secundatum) and shade-adapted blends of zoysia exceed bermuda. Tall fescue (Festuca arundinacea) mixed with Kentucky bluegrass adds cool-season color but may decline in summer heat without irrigation. Consider disease resistance (brown patch, spring dead spot), thatch propensity, and leaf blade width. Match sod to soil pH, drainage class, and intended use intensity.
Professional Installation and Continuous Maintenance
Beginning with site evaluation through first mowing, professional installation and maintenance emphasize soil physics, plant physiology, and Fayetteville's transition-zone constraints. You'll begin with compaction testing, pH and CEC analysis, then precision grading for surface runoff. Install sod on moist, firm subgrade with staggered seams, ensuring root-stem contact and immediate root-zone hydration via drip irrigation that targets the three-to-four inch profile. Apply starter fertilizer adjusted to soil test, then enforce traffic exclusion until root tensile strength meets tug-test thresholds.
You will calibrate mowing height to grass cultivar morphology, keep sharp blades to limit xylem cavitation risk, and schedule irrigation using evapotranspiration rates. Implement seasonal overseeding to sustain tiller density and suppress weed intrusion. Observe thatch accumulation, adjust nitrogen timing, and implement integrated pest scouting to anticipate biotic stress.
Sustainable Approaches That Save Water and Improve Soil Health
Once installation and maintenance protocols established, you can now enhance inputs with practices that preserve water and build robust soil composition. Install smart irrigation with evapotranspiration-based scheduling and matched-precipitation nozzles to reduce runoff and deep percolation. Set precipitation rates to soil infiltration capacity, then irrigate to field capacity, not saturation.
Apply mulch layers 2-3 inches deep using shredded hardwood bark or pine needle mulch to prevent evaporation, moderate soil temperature, and improve mycorrhizal networks. Add compost at 5-10% by volume to boost cation exchange capacity and microbial biomass, enhancing aggregate stability.
Design rain gardens downslope to catch rooftop and lawn runoff; size basins for 1-inch storm events and plant deep-rooted graminoids and facultative perennials. Perforate compacted zones, then topdress with screened compost to revive drainage and moisture retention.

What Are Standard Pricing Rates for Lawn Care and Sod Installation in Fayetteville?
Anticipate lawn care to cost $35-$70 per mow, $90-$150 aeration, $60-$120 fertilization, and $50-$100 weed control per application. Sod installation typically runs $1.50-$2.75 per sq ft. Pricing ranges reflect grass variety, soil prep, and site complexity. Material breakdown: sod (60% to 75%), soil amendments (compost, lime, starter fertilizer 5% to 10%), irrigation setup (between 10-15%), and labor (20% to 35%). Zoysiagrass is more expensive than bermudagrass; compaction remediation and grade correction raise expenses.
